Physical maps have been our main method of navigating for thousands of years. However, the advent of GPS and smartphones have challenged their need.
Have these apps killed off printed hiking maps like the dinosaurs? How exactly have our methods of navigation changed? And how helpful are the new hiking apps, really?
We interviewed FarOut Guides, Andrew Skurka, and David 'AWOL' Miller to find out.
